public interface UserData extends CachedData
User.
All calls will account for inheritance, as well as any default data provided by the platform. This calls are heavily cached and are therefore fast.
For meta, both methods accepting Contexts and MetaContexts are provided. The only difference is that
the latter allows you to define how the meta stack should be structured internally. Where Contexts are passed, the
values from the configuration are used.
calculateMeta, calculateMeta, calculatePermissions, getMetaData, getMetaData, getPermissionData, invalidateMeta, invalidateMeta, invalidateMeta, invalidatePermissionCalculators, invalidatePermissions, invalidatePermissions, preCalculate, preCalculate, recalculateMeta, recalculateMeta, recalculateMeta, recalculatePermissions, recalculatePermissions, reloadMeta, reloadMeta, reloadMeta, reloadPermissions, reloadPermissions